Abstract

The invention relates to a rotary drive device and image forming apparatus, providing a rotary drive device with excellent assembly performance, excellent maintenance performance, increased accuracy of a sensor, increased load resistance, comprising a motor (200) including a rotary shaft (203); an outer gear (101), fixed on a case (202) of the motor (202); a plurality of planetary gear mechanisms (100), using the outer gear (101) as a common outer gear, decelerating a rotation output of the motor (200); an output shaft (117) transmitting the decelerated rotation output of the motor to an outside of the rotary drive device; a rotation position detector (300) detecting a rotation position of the output shaft (117). The motor (200), the planetary gear mechanism (100), and the rotation position detector (300) are combined into a single integrated unit and aligned in an axial direction of the rotary shaft (203) of the motor (200).

Background technique [0002] Conventionally, there is an electrophotographic image forming apparatus that supports color images. [0003] The image forming device arranges a photoreceptor along the intermediate transfer belt, forms color-separated toner images of each color (including black) on the photoreceptor, arranges a primary transfer roller opposite the photoreceptor, and sandwiches the intermediate transfer roller. The toner image on the photoreceptor is transferred to the intermediate transfer belt, and the toner images of each color are superimposed on the intermediate transfer belt to form a color toner image. The above-mentioned color toner image is transferred to the secondary transfer roller.
